Patent number: 11572720Abstract: A closet unit for a vehicle and a threshold assembly for use with a door are provided. The threshold assembly includes a threshold body that is coupleable to a frame of the closet unit with the threshold body including an opening formed therethrough. The threshold assembly further includes a striker component, in which the striker component includes a plate removably coupleable to the threshold body and a cup coupled to and offset from a center of the plate with the cup positionable through the opening of the threshold body. The threshold assembly further includes a fastener to removably couple the plate of the striker component to the threshold body.Type: GrantFiled: July 17, 2018Date of Patent: February 7, 2023Assignee: THE BOEING COMPANYInventor: Saif Sultan

Publication number: 20220316521Abstract: A tie-rod with a swivel tie-rod end includes a tie-rod central rod and a first tie-rod end including a swivel joint. The first tie-rod end is connected to the tie-rod central rod by the swivel joint. The swivel joint is operable to enable rotation of the first tie-rod end with respect to the tie-rod central rod while maintaining a common longitudinal axis between the first tie-rod end and the tie-rod central rod. The tie-rod further includes a second tie-rod end connected to the tie-rod central rod.Type: ApplicationFiled: March 22, 2022Publication date: October 6, 2022Applicant: The Boeing CompanyInventors: Saif Sultan, Sean R. Patent number: 11421721Abstract: A tie-rod assembly includes a tube member having a first set of threads at a first end of the tube member and a second set of threads at a second end of the tube member. The tie-rod assembly includes a first clevis coupling assembly having a first width dimension and a third set of threads compatible with first set of threads and first clevis coupling assembly has a second width dimension which includes a portion of the third set of threads with the second width dimension greater than the first width dimension. Further included is second clevis coupling assembly having a third width dimension and a fourth set of threads compatible with second set of threads and the second clevis coupling assembly has a fourth width dimension which includes a portion of the fourth set of threads with the fourth width dimension greater than the third width dimension.Type: GrantFiled: August 22, 2019Date of Patent: August 23, 2022Assignee: THE BOEING COMPANYInventors: Saif Sultan, Edward H. Patent number: 11260903Abstract: Apparatus, systems, and methods that include a variable length linkage for connecting together tie rods. The linkage includes first, second, and third apertures. There is a first distance between the first aperture and the second aperture and a second distance between the first aperture and the third aperture. The apparatus may include a fourth aperture having a third distance between the first aperture and the fourth aperture. The second, third, and fourth apertures may each have a non-circular cross-section. The linkage may include a base, a first finger, a second finger, and a third finger that each extend from the base. The first aperture may be in the base, the second aperture may be in the first finger, the third aperture may be in the second finger, and the fourth aperture may be in the third finger. The first aperture may be oriented vertically with the other apertures oriented horizontally.Type: GrantFiled: March 16, 2020Date of Patent: March 1, 2022Assignee: THE BOEING COMPANYInventors: Saif Sultan, Joshua R. Patent number: 10354023Abstract: A method and apparatus for transforming a finite element model is provided. A set of joint elements to the finite element model of a structure is created at a set of joint locations in the finite element model of the structure. A local coordinate system is assigned to each of the set of joint elements that is independent of a global coordinate system of the finite element model to generate a transformed finite element model. The transformed finite element model is generated with improved consistency and efficiency.Type: GrantFiled: December 10, 2014Date of Patent: July 16, 2019Assignee: The Boeing CompanyInventors: Saif Sultan, Weidong Song, Nooshin M. Patent number: 9097003Abstract: Saddle bracket assemblies and corresponding methods of assembly and/or use are disclosed. Saddle brackets comprise two bracket members, a male bracket member and a female bracket member. The bracket members are configured to mate to a panel, such as a sandwich panel, through one or more panel passages through the panel. The bracket members generally have an L-shaped profile with two arms. The male bracket member includes one or more standoffs affixed to one arm, the standoff(s) being configured to fit the panel passage(s). The saddle bracket is assembled by inserting the standoff(s) through the panel passage(s), aligning the female bracket member to the standoff(s) and/or the panel passage(s), and securing the bracket members together with one or more panel connectors coupling the standoff(s) of the male bracket member, though the panel passage(s), to the female bracket member.Type: GrantFiled: May 19, 2014Date of Patent: August 4, 2015Assignee: The Boeing CompanyInventors: Saif Sultan, Bogdan M.
